North Texas Cracks Top Ten In Latest Poll

DENTON, Texas (12/29/08) - The North Texas swimming & diving team broke into the Top 10 by receiving a No. 10 ranking in the latest CSCAA/CollegeSwimming.com Mid-Major Poll released on Monday.

The Mean Green moved up four spots from the last poll which had been out since November 25.

North Texas last competed on November 23 posting a second place finish out of nine schools at the Husker Invite featuring the likes of Rice, Colorado State, Iowa State, and Nebraska. Rice won the meet followed by North Texas then Colorado State.

The team also set six new school records in the 100 Freestyle, 1000 Freestyle, 1650 Freestyle, 100 Butterfly, 200 Butterfly, and the 800 Freestyle Relay.

Three other Sun Belt schools also earned a Top 25 spot in the latest Mid-Major poll. The Hilltoppers of Western Kentucky placed the highest at fifth, New Orleans at 23rd, and Florida Atlantic in 24th. The Mean Green defeated New Orleans earlier in the season and face the Owls of FAU on January 3.

North Texas also has some familiarity with No. 8 ranked Missouri State. At the North Texas Relays back on October 3, the Mean Green finished ahead of the Bears out of five schools who competed. 

The CollegeSwimming.com rankings are based on the best dual meet lineup for each team as decided by participating schools. Rankings are released four times throughout the season November (Pre-Invite), December (Post-Invite), February (Pre-Conference), and March (Post-Conference).

North Texas is back in action this weekend at the FAU Invite in Boca Raton, Florida on Saturday.
